Anyways, the trapezoid A B C D ABCD has A B = 3 AB = 3 , B C = 10 BC = 10 , C D = 12 CD = 12 , D A = 5 DA = 5

Find B D BD if the measurement of B D BD is an integer.

There are two possibilities. [1] AB||DC, or [2] BC||AD.
Try [1]:- From A drop a perpendicular AE, E on DC. From B drop a perpendicular BF, F on DC.
In rectangle AEFB, EF=AB=3.
So DE+FC=9. Let DE=X, and we get FC=9-x.
Since height, h=AE=BF,
In right triangles ADE and BFC, 5 2 X 2 = h = 1 0 2 ( 9 X ) 2 . S o X = 1 / 3. h 2 = 5 2 ( 1 / 3 ) 2 = 224 / 9 I n r i g h t t r i a n g l e B D F , B D 2 = h 2 + D F 2 = 224 / 9 + ( 10 / 3 ) 2 = 36. B D = 6. 5^2-X^2=h=10^2-(9-X)^2.\\ So~X=1/3.~~~~~~~~~h^2=5^2-(1/3)^2=224/9\\ In ~right~ triangle~ BDF,~~~ BD^2= h^2+DF^2=224/9+(10/3)^2=36.\\ \therefore~~~BD=\color{#D61F06}{6}.
